EPSRC held our regional engagement event in the Midlands this week. Huge thank yous to Aston University for hosting and Midlands Innovation for partnering with us. It was a fantastic opportunity to celebrate the great work going on across the EPS community, hear about the latest challenges and opportunities, and talk about our collective priorities. EPSRC Executive Chair Charlotte Deane gave the plenary talk emphasising the need to work together to: - Future proof the STEM workforce for the productivity of UK plc  - Build a sustainable and vibrant National Capability in research and infrastructure for science-driven growth; and - Catalyse the research and innovation the UK needs in Critical Technologies and Net Zero We also had thought provoking talks from Lisa Smith on Midlands Mindforge, Simon Breeden and Lucy Williams on the Technician Commitment, and Helen Turner on support for people. Thank you to Professor Mike Caine and Professor Caroline Meyer for chairing the sessions. Discussions were wide ranging in the afternoon, focussing on the Innovation and People that EPSRC support.
